Key Takeaways:
  • The forest products sector wants product quickly, creating a preference for truck freight. Modal shift in forest is particularly for lumber and wood.
  • There are underly economic drivers, record-low mortgage rates, and people wanting extra space in their home for work and school.
  • Metal scrap is seeing strong demand to bring goods to market and use scrap in the manufacturing process. Metal scrap is an outlier and a source of strength. 
  • Scrap metal movements are a good underlying indicator of the health of manufacturing. 
  • Scrap prices being up also incentivizes scrapping of cars.
